Donkeys found dead near Raigad Fort: Animal husbandry department warns contractors against animal cruelty | Mumbai News

Navi Mumbai: Days after five donkeys used for transporting construction materials at Raigad Fort were found dead, assistant commissioner of animal husbandry department Subhash Dalvi inspected the area on Wednesday. The department has written to the contractors and authorities warning them of action for animal cruelty.Activists alleged that contractors use around 150 donkeys instead of…

Karnataka braces for weak monsoon, water stress looms in 213 taluks | Bengaluru News

Bengaluru: Karnataka is staring at a potential water stress year with forecasts of a below-normal monsoon across most regions, prompting the govt to activate contingency measures and tighten accountability among district administrations.Citing inputs from the India Meteorological Department, chief minister Siddaramaiah said Thursday that barring five districts, much of the state is likely to face…
